Output 26084061dda86e0b654a0e8c86aef71ebb2b701588425e3f0be0ff2ac66b0f6a:1

value
1704205
script pubkey
OP_0 OP_PUSHBYTES_20 fb5d4f1a589a633b6da3cd72e21d98c35060177e
address
ltc1qldw57xjcnf3nkmdre4ewy8vccdgxq9m7n89v77
transaction
26084061dda86e0b654a0e8c86aef71ebb2b701588425e3f0be0ff2ac66b0f6a
spent
true